Tremeirchion - Corpus Christi

Ordnance Survey reference SJ 083731


Tremeirchion is one of the "ancient parishes" of Flintshire. It comprises the five townships of Bryngwyn Esgob, Maenefa, Llan, Graig and Bachegraig.

Some parts of the church date from the fourteenth century. There have been additions through the centuries, and there was extensive restoration and rebuilding in 1864.

The church was in Flintshire until 1974; and in Clwyd from 1974 until 1996.

It is now in "new" Denbighshire.
